Headed out friday 100 ft and trolled over live bottom for a while hoping for a stray wahoo. One large amberjack (which almost spooled us) and a small barracuda so decided to bag the trolling and go grocery shopping. Tried out my new colored per depth spectra which was nice to try and target fish suspended in the water column. Scamp, liners, bsb, triggers and even a nice little cobia. Scamp were hitting live pinfish like niedermeier on a bucket of chicken.Patchy fog on the way in got pretty thick at times so Im glad I had radar.

Fished last Thursday, got 3 wahoo all on high speed. Lost a 4th. All 3 were around 40 lbs. 150-200 ft

Saturday was beautiful. 80 degree air temp, 75 water temp in 100 ft. Limit of b-liners, couple big triggers, couple seabass, grunts, few AJ with one over 50 lb. and a bonus ~8 ish lb November dolphin on a bottom rig. :sunglasses:
